Zusammenfassung: | The invention relates to a gel composite water plugging method for a heavy oil thermal recovery producing well and application of the gel composite water plugging method, and belongs to the technical field of heavy oil water plugging. The gel composite water plugging method comprises the following steps that a foaming agent, first nitrogen, a gel profile control agent, a fly ash profile control agent and second nitrogen are sequentially injected, and a nitrogen foam slug, a gel slug, a fly ash slug and a nitrogen slug are sequentially formed to plug a water channeling dominant channel; the total volume V of the foaming agent, the first nitrogen, the gel profile control agent, the fly ash profile control agent and the second nitrogen is equal to piR2h phi; the water plugging radius is selected to be 12-16 m after 5-10 turns of huff and puff, and the water plugging radius is selected to be 16-25 m after more than 10 turns of huff and puff.
